Why overloaded trucks and brake failures travel together
A tractor-trailer’s braking system is engineered to stop a known maximum gross vehicle weight, often 80,000 pounds for interstate travel in the United States. That number assumes properly adjusted air brakes, balanced loads, and drivers using engine retarders on grades. When shippers push above the legal limit, even by 5 to 10 percent, braking distances increase. Add heat from long downhill stretches or stop-and-go urban traffic, and the linings can overheat. Once the friction material gets too hot, it loses coefficient of friction, a phenomenon drivers call fade. The pedal still feels firm, the air pressure holds, but the truck simply does not slow like it should.
I handled a case where a regional carrier accepted a last-minute hot load of roofing shingles. The bills of lading showed 44,000 pounds, yet the post-crash weigh-in on the surviving axles, extrapolated for lost wheels, put the gross weight above 86,000. The driver started down a familiar grade and applied steady pressure instead of using a lower gear. By the third curve, the brakes were smoking, and the rig plowed into slowing traffic. The carrier tried to blame the driver. The maintenance records told a fuller story: thin linings on two axles, an out-of-adjustment slack adjuster, and no evidence of a pre-trip inspection on the day of the run. Overloading magnified each defect.
The mechanical chain: how brake systems fail under stress
Air brakes are robust, but they have weak links. Overloading exposes them.
Heat buildup and fade: As linings overheat, gases form at the friction surface, reducing bite. At roughly 600 to 800 degrees Fahrenheit, many standard linings lose effectiveness. Long grades can push temperatures higher, especially if the driver rides the brakes.
Out-of-adjustment brakes: Automatic slack adjusters are supposed to keep shoe-to-drum clearance within spec, yet they depend on regular brake applications and correct installation. If one wheel end is out of adjustment, it contributes less stopping force. Under heavy loads, the remaining wheels shoulder too much, overheating faster.
Glazed drums and cracked rotors: Excessive heat can glaze drum surfaces or crack rotors on disc-equipped axles. Glaze reduces friction, while cracks risk catastrophic failure. I have seen spiderweb cracks on inside faces that a cursory inspection would miss.
Air system deficiencies: Leaks, contaminated air dryers, or water in lines can reduce effective pressure, especially in cold conditions. An overloaded rig with marginal air supply is a bad combination.
Mixed or mismatched components: Installing linings with different temperature ratings across axles can create imbalance. The hotter-running corners overheat and fade first when weight is high.
A competent investigation tests each link. You do not assume a single cause when trucks are this complex. You test, measure, and compare.
The legal framework: where liability attaches
Claims involving overloaded trucks and brake failure rest on several legal theories. One is straightforward negligence by the driver for speed and following distance given the conditions. Another is negligent maintenance by the motor carrier, shown by thin linings, missed inspections, or ignored out-of-service violations. We also look at negligent loading by the shipper or broker, particularly when the carrier relied on shipper-supplied weights that were knowingly inaccurate, or when cargo was misdistributed across axles, overloading one set of brakes.
Regulations matter. Federal Motor Carrier Safety Regulations set the rules on maximum weights, brake maintenance, and driver inspection duties. For instance, 49 C.F.R. Part 393 covers brake performance and component condition. Part 396 requires systematic inspection, repair, and maintenance. Part 392 and 395 touch driving practices and hours, which affect fatigue, a common companion to poor braking decisions on grades. These rules do not just provide guidance. They establish duties. A violation of a safety regulation can support negligence per se in many jurisdictions, meaning the breach itself helps prove fault.
There is also product liability. If a brake component fractures under normal use and within rated loads, the manufacturer may bear responsibility. Those cases turn on laboratory testing and metallurgical analysis, not just logbooks. Still, in my experience, pure product defects are rare compared to maintenance and loading errors.
Evidence that makes or breaks an overloaded truck case
Time is a quiet enemy. Tractor-trailers get repaired or scrapped. Electronic data overwrites. Cargo gets offloaded. The first calls we make seek to lock down evidence.
We send preservation letters to the motor carrier and its insurer instructing them to retain the tractor, trailer, brake components, ECM data, driver logs, bills of lading, scale tickets, fuel receipts, and any dashcam video. We often move for a temporary restraining order if a carrier signals it will put the rig back into service. I have seen a brake chamber tossed in a shop’s scrap bin within a week, which erased a clear clue to an air leak near a pushrod seal.
The ECM or engine control module can show vehicle speed, brake application, and throttle position seconds before impact. Some modern trailers also have ABS event codes. Paired with physical evidence like skid marks, yaw marks, and gouges, these data points help reconstruct speeds and deceleration. On grades, I look for signs of smoke staining along the trailer sides, which photographs capture well soon after a crash.
Weight proof comes from several sources. If the truck stopped at a weigh station earlier in the route, records may exist. Bills of lading and scale tickets from the loading facility often list pallet counts and unit weights. When shippers claim not to weigh, we request internal emails and SOPs. More than once, a shipper’s forklift scale readouts saved the day. The role of driver behavior and training
Even with a legal load, poorly chosen techniques can precipitate brake failure. A trained driver will descend a mountain grade in a low gear, use the engine retarder, and rely on light, intermittent brake applications to avoid heat buildup. Running fast at the top of a descent and dragging the brakes all the way down is a recipe for fade. Training programs should cover mountain driving, weight distribution, and equipment limits. Carriers who assign new drivers to heavy routes without this instruction invite trouble.
Driver inspection duties matter too. Pre-trip inspections should include brake checks — listening for leaks, checking pushrod travel, and noting thin linings. Some drivers treat these as paperwork chores. When I take a deposition and hear “I do the same pre-trip every day, takes three minutes,” I know we may find issues. A thorough brake check takes longer. Documentation that reflects shortcuts undermines a defense that “we had no idea” about maintenance problems.
How an experienced truck accident lawyer builds the case
Choosing a truck accident lawyer with genuine experience changes the outcome. Trucking claims require a different playbook than a typical car crash attorney might use. I bring in mechanical engineers with heavy vehicle experience, brake specialists, and sometimes former DOT inspectors. We schedule a joint inspection of the tractor and trailer, measure pushrod travel on each wheel end, check lining thickness, and look for heat checking on drums. If components have been disturbed, we note that and press the spoliation angle.
We also analyze company systems. Did the carrier’s maintenance software flag out-of-service brakes and late inspections? Were drivers trained in mountain driving and proper use of retarders? What incentives were in place that might pressure drivers to accept overweight loads? Emails often reveal that dispatch knew the load ran heavy, but declined to split it because the route skirted permanent scales. That knowledge can shift the blame from the individual driver to the company that set the conditions.
When brake failure interacts with other factors, the web grows. Was the driver fatigued after exceeding hours of service? Did weather reduce friction and make brake fade more dangerous? Did a construction zone compress traffic so tightly that even compliant stopping distances failed? A personal injury attorney with trucking fluency integrates these variables into a coherent narrative that a jury can follow without a mechanics textbook.

Common defenses and how to meet them
Carriers and their insurers often argue that brake failure was sudden and unforeseeable, that the driver did everything a reasonable person would do, or that a shipper lied about weight. They may blame the car in front for braking hard or claim you cut in too closely. When a pedestrian or motorcycle rider is involved, they may focus on visibility or lane position. A motorcycle accident lawyer or pedestrian accident attorney who understands truck dynamics can rebut those narratives with data.
Sudden emergency defenses falter when maintenance records show a pattern of defects. If a truck had three roadside inspections in six months with brake violations, the company knew or should have known the system needed attention. If the ECM shows speeds inconsistent with a safe grade descent, the emergency was self-inflicted. And when loading documents or axle weight readings prove overloading, the notion of unforeseeability collapses, because overweight loads are known to impair braking.
Comparative fault arguments deserve respect, because juries assess share of blame. Even if a car changed lanes too closely, a truck that was overweight and could not stop reasonably remains liable for a significant portion. The evidence tells that story when presented clearly.
Special angles: third-party liability beyond the carrier
Overweight and brake cases often involve more than driver and carrier. The shipper who loaded the cargo and certified weights may face liability if it misrepresented load weight or forced sealed loads with no chance for the driver to verify. Brokers that pushed unrealistic schedules can share fault in some jurisdictions. Maintenance contractors who performed brake work without proper adjustment or installed mixed linings may bear a share.
Occasionally, a municipality or state agency enters the frame if a downgrade lacked adequate signage or safety ramps. Many mountain passes have runaway truck ramps for a reason. If a ramp was closed without proper warning, that becomes part of the causation analysis. What to do after a suspected brake failure crash
Victims rarely have the luxury of conducting investigations from the scene. Still, small steps preserve later options.
If safe, photograph the truck’s wheels for signs of smoke, scorched paint, or melted hubcaps, and capture any smoke streams along the trailer sides. These images help experts assess heat and timing.
Note the sounds and smells: hissing air, burning odor, or visible flames at wheels. Sensory details, recorded in a phone note or text to a family member, carry evidentiary weight when memories fade.
Ask police to document skid marks, yaw marks, and debris fields carefully, and request they consider commercial vehicle enforcement assistance for an on-scene brake inspection.
Seek medical evaluation promptly, even if you feel “mostly okay.” Adrenaline masks injuries. Timely records connect symptoms to the crash.

How overloaded cargo shows up outside classic freight
Not every overloaded truck is a long-haul tractor-trailer. Local dumps and landscaping outfits sometimes stack dump trucks past their rated GVWR. Utility companies may overload service bodies with equipment. Even moving trucks rented for a weekend can be overweight when a family loads a garage full of gym equipment and tools into a mid-size box. I handled a case where a rental truck’s rear axle sat nearly on its bump stops. Brakes overheated on a short hill and the driver rear-ended a line of cars at a light. The company pointed to contract language placing responsibility on the renter. We focused on the truck’s maintenance — thin pads, no recent inspection — and the absence of any guidance about weight limits beyond a worn sticker. Mixed responsibility still yielded a settlement adequate to cover surgeries and long rehab.

Insurance negotiations and the long arc of litigation
Insurers for motor carriers are sophisticated. They often deploy rapid response teams to crash scenes. By the time a victim hires counsel, the other side may already have photos and witness statements. That asymmetry is real. Closing the gap requires speed and persistence.
In negotiation, facts win. A lab report confirming overheated, glazed linings on three wheel ends and out-of-adjustment pushrod travel on two others tells a story a claims adjuster knows a jury will understand. ECM data showing prolonged brake application on a grade without downshifting undermines the notion that “nothing could be done.” When a shipper’s email admits “we’re over by a couple thousand, roll it anyway,” settlement value climbs.
If an insurer digs in, filing suit unlocks discovery and depositions. Drivers who present well sometimes concede critical details when asked about mountain driving practices or whether they felt fade before the crash. Maintenance supervisors who testify, “we rely on drivers to tell us if something’s wrong,” do not help the defense if their shop was flagged repeatedly for overdue inspections. Trial is rare, but preparing as if you will pick a jury keeps pressure on for a fair resolution.
